Science In Action - Dispute over ancient Skull settled with a CAT scan - 91Èȱ¬ Sounds

Science In Action - Dispute over ancient Skull settled with a CAT scan - 91Èȱ¬ Sounds


Dispute over ancient Skull settled with a CAT scan

Ancient skull was one of our earliest hominid ancestors

Coming Up Next